Seattle Mayor Katie Wilson offered little reaction when pressed publicly about the now-abandoned campaign to remove her from office.

The 44-year-old Democrat notched a legal win this week after recall organizers pulled their petition from King County Elections in Washington. The filing had alleged Wilson committed “malfeasance” and violated her oath of office.

On Saturday, Wilson was approached about the collapsed recall effort by Jonathan Choe, a senior journalism fellow at the Discovery Institute.

The exchange began politely enough, with Choe asking the mayor how she was doing. Wilson responded warmly: “I’m doing great, Jonathan.”

But the tone shifted as soon as Choe raised the recall. Wilson stopped engaging and did not answer his follow-up questions.

“Mayor, I was just going to say congrats on surviving the recall attempt,” Choe said. “What have you learned from this process and what are you going to do differently as mayor?”

Wilson kept walking, head lowered, offering no response as Choe continued trying to draw out an answer.

He then rephrased the question, asking: “Are there any lessons you learned from this recall process?”

Still, Wilson continued walking away silently as she playfully swung her child around.

In the now-defunct recall petition, Melinda Jacobson and her husband, Dale Osterud, cited the mayor’s inadequate handling of the Bite of Seattle shooting last month that saw three gunned down at a food festival. 

They also addressed the persistent crime rate in the downtown area of Aurora Avenue and Chinatown International District and questioned Wilson’s decision to turn off CCTV cameras after the World Cup.

But the couple missed a filing deadline last Wednesday, only to show up in court the next day saying they were out of town due to family matters. 

Judge Patrick Oishi, who was assigned to the case, then said their behavior was ‘absolutely inappropriate,’ according to the Seattle Times

He said he had been in the dark about their arrival as he struggled to figure out what was going on as Wilson’s attorneys, Dmitri Iglitzin and Abby Lawlor, blasted the charges as ‘frivolous.’

Yet Jacobson doubled down – claiming she had found new information related to the charges and wanted to investigate further. 

She did not describe what the new details were. Instead, she explained that she retained a lawyer to help restart the process and did not reveal their identity.

Jacobson said she had contacted multiple lawyers to take her case but that ‘too many attorneys in this city don’t want to handle a political situation.’ 

When the couple then requested to rescind their petition, Judge Oishi signed the order without prejudice.

If the couple now seeks to restart the recall petition, they would need nearly 70,000 verified signatures from other supporters.

But Wilson’s lawyers have also warned that the mayor could seek sanctions against Jacobson if the recall petition is restarted.

Outside of the courthouse on Thursday, Jacobson defended her actions.

‘She’s had nothing but a series of rash decisions and people are angry,’ she said of the mayor, according to KIRO.

‘I may appear angry right now but I represent a lot of citizens of Seattle, and this is not going to go unsaid. It’s not over.’

Wilson has become increasingly unpopular in liberal Seattle after she mocked wealthy entrepreneurs who announced plans to move out of the city over a new wealth tax and called for a boycott of Starbucks, which was founded there in 1971 and remains headquartered there.

Wilson has since sought to backtrack after multiple CEOs blasted her policies and said they were leaving, with Starbucks gradually shifting staff to its Nashville offices, amid growing rumors it will ultimately quit its home city altogether.
